Ingredients

Ingredients:
– 1 large cucumber (or about 6 mini cucumbers), chopped into bite-sized pieces
– 1/2 red onion, sliced
– 1/4 cup feta, crumbled
– 1/3 cup olive oil
– 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
– 1 teaspoon dried oregano
– Salt and pepper to taste

How to Make Cucumber Feta Salad

Step 1: Chop the Cucumbers

  1. Begin by chopping the large cucumber into bite-sized pieces. If using mini cucumbers, slice them accordingly.
  2. Place the chopped cucumber in a mixing bowl.

Step 2: Add Remaining Ingredients

  1. Slice the red onion thinly and add it to the bowl with cucumbers.
  2. Crumble the feta cheese over the top.
  3. Pour in the olive oil and red wine vinegar.

Step 3: Season and Toss

  1. Sprinkle dried oregano over the mixture along with salt and pepper to taste.
  2. Toss everything together until well mixed. Ensure each piece is coated in dressing.
  3. Taste the salad and adjust seasoning if needed before serving.

How to Perfect Cucumber Feta Salad

To make your Cucumber Feta Salad even more delightful, consider these simple tips that enhance flavor and presentation.

  • Choose Fresh Ingredients: Always use fresh cucumbers and high-quality feta cheese for the best taste.
  • Let It Chill: Allow the salad to chill in the fridge for at least 30 minutes before serving—it brings out the flavors.
  • Add More Veggies: Feel free to incorporate other vegetables like bell peppers or cherry tomatoes for added color and nutrition.
  • Experiment with Herbs: Try using fresh herbs like parsley or mint instead of dried oregano for a vibrant twist.

Ingredients

  • 1 large cucumber (or 6 mini cucumbers), chopped
  • 1/2 red onion, thinly sliced
  • 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ese
  • 1/3 cup ol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Chop the cucumber into bite-sized pieces and place in a mixing bowl.
  2. Add sliced red onion and crumbled feta cheese.
  3. Drizzle olive oil and red wine vinegar over the mixture.
  4. Season with dried oregano, salt, and pepper.
  5. Toss well to combine, ensuring all ingredients are coated in dressing.
